- In a highly competitive match featuring multiple near pinfalls, Kofi Kingston emerged victorious over Christian with Trouble in Paradise to claim the vacated Intercontinental Title. Or so he thought. Moments after basking in the glory, "former" champion Drew McIntyre entered the ring and hand-delivered a letter to SmackDown General Manager Theodore Long. After reading the contents of the letter, the GM requested Kofi return the coveted title to him. After much hesitation, Kofi reluctantly complied with the GM, who then handed over the title to McIntyre. Later, Matt Striker revealed the letter prompting Long's actions was from Mr. McMahon, who declared Drew officially reinstated to the active roster and is still champion.
